June 8, 2024 · Bury, United Kingdom ·. The relatively new Pip review forms are not quite as simple as they appear. We are getting increasingly concerned about the amount of people who are reassessed after completing a review form and stating no change, who are then given fewer points or have their award removed altogether.

A stock picture of money (Image: PA) When the Department for Work and Pensions (DWP) awards someone a Personal Independence Payment (PIP) award they will be informed in writing at the time how long it will last. PIP awards can be given for anywhere between three months to 10 years, …
